this week, confushian gets hold of some software, and mashes up some wicked beats with fruity loops, before pressing the delete button and getting the ukelele out to show the kids what real music sounds like, all sounds by confushian, (even the loud banging ones). The photo is a reference to the white heat of technology, made famous by turntablist MC Harold Wilson who suprisingly moonlighted as British PM.
